1919 United States 1/2 Dollar inscriptions & design

Obverse

LIBERTY/ IN GOD/ WE TRUST/ in exergue, 1919

Liberty walking l., holding branch. rising sun l.

Reverse

UNITED . STATES . OF . AMERICA ./ HALF . DOLLAR

eagle standing., facing l., wings outstretched
